I had a hysterectomy when I was 36 years old. Post surgery, I was always tired, moody, and had decreased libido. I started on traditional hormone replacement and experienced headaches, nausea, and other unwanted side effects. My gyn at the time started me on compounded HRT, the dosing based on hormone levels in my bloodwork. Compounded HRT allowed me to get exactly what I needed and nothing else. My dose has been reduced as I aged, reflection what would naturally happen to me without a hysterectomy. I am now 67 years old, with a wonderful quality of life. I am active (run half-marathons), remain happily married, and accomplished career goals after my surgery that I know would have been almost impossible without the support of this medication.
